10 Inch vs 12 Inch Miter Saw Comparison
The choice between 10-inch and 12-inch miter saws significantly impacts workshop functionality, project capabilities, and budget considerations. Understanding these differences helps optimize your tool investment based on actual cutting requirements rather than perceived advantages of larger blade capacity.
| Feature | 10 Inch Models | 12 Inch Models | Best Choice For |
|---|---|---|---|
| Cutting Capacity | Up to 6" vertical | Up to 8" vertical | 12" for large moldings |
| Weight | 30-45 pounds | 50-70 pounds | 10" for portability |
| Blade Cost | More economical | Higher cost | 10" for budget operation |
| Power Requirements | 13-15 amp typical | 15 amp standard | Varies by application |
| Value Range | More accessible | Premium investment | 10" for value-conscious buyers |

Cutting Capacity and Dimensional Limitations
Understanding the precise cutting capacity of DEWALT 10-inch miter saws helps determine their suitability for specific project requirements. These limitations define the range of materials you can process effectively without requiring alternative cutting methods or larger equipment.
Dimensional Cutting Capabilities
- Maximum Crosscut: 2x8 lumber at 90 degrees with standard fence position
- Miter Capacity: 2x6 lumber at 45-degree miter angle
- Bevel Cutting: 2x6 lumber at 45-degree bevel (single bevel models)
- Crown Molding: 4.5-inch crown nested against fence and table
- Baseboard Trim: 4.5-inch baseboard positioned vertically against fence
Material Thickness Considerations
The relationship between blade diameter and cutting depth becomes critical when working with thick stock or laminated materials. DEWALT 10-inch saws typically achieve maximum cutting depths of approximately 3.5 inches at 90 degrees, with reduced capacity as miter or bevel angles increase.
💡 Capacity Optimization Tips
According to industry recommendations, maximize your saw's cutting capacity by using thin-kerf blades that reduce material waste and require less power. Consider table saw miter gauge alternatives for cuts exceeding your miter saw's capacity limits.

Cut Line Indication Systems
Modern DEWALT 10-inch miter saws may incorporate laser guide systems or LED shadow lines designed to improve cutting accuracy. These systems help position material precisely relative to the blade path, reducing measurement errors and improving cut quality.
⚠️ Laser System Limitations
Laser guide systems require periodic calibration and can become misaligned with blade changes. Always verify laser accuracy with test cuts before critical operations.
Optimal Blade Selection for DEWALT 10 Inch Saws
Selecting appropriate blades for DEWALT 10-inch miter saws dramatically impacts cutting performance, surface quality, and operational efficiency. The blade choice affects everything from cut smoothness to motor load, making this decision crucial for optimal tool performance.
Blade Types and Applications
Different blade configurations excel in specific cutting applications, and understanding these relationships helps optimize cutting results across various project requirements. The interaction between tooth count, tooth geometry, and cutting speed determines the final surface quality and cutting efficiency.
| Blade Type | Tooth Count | Best Applications | Cut Quality |
|---|---|---|---|
| General Purpose | 40-50 teeth | Mixed materials, versatility | Good overall performance |
| Fine Crosscut | 60-80 teeth | Hardwoods, trim work | Excellent surface finish |
| Plywood Special | 80+ teeth | Sheet goods, veneered materials | Minimal tearout |
| Rough Cutting | 24-30 teeth | Construction lumber, framing | Fast cutting, rough finish |

Maintenance and Care for DEWALT 10 Inch Saws
Proper maintenance procedures extend the operational life of DEWALT 10-inch miter saws while maintaining cutting accuracy and performance. Regular care prevents common issues and is designed to ensure consistent results throughout the tool's service life.
Routine Maintenance Schedule
Establishing a regular maintenance routine prevents accuracy drift and mechanical problems that can compromise cutting quality. These procedures require minimal time investment but provide substantial benefits in tool longevity and performance consistency.
✓ Daily Maintenance Tasks
- Dust Removal: Clear sawdust from all moving parts and adjustment mechanisms
- Fence Inspection: Verify fence alignment and tightness before use
- Blade Condition: Check for damage, dullness, or resin buildup
- Table Cleaning: Remove debris and apply paste wax for smooth operation
- Angle Verification: Confirm critical angle settings remain accurate
Long-term Care Procedures
Periodic maintenance procedures address wear patterns and calibration drift that develop over extended use. These tasks are designed to ensure your DEWALT 10-inch saw maintains factory-level accuracy and performance throughout its operational life.
Key long-term maintenance tasks include:
- Calibration Verification: Monthly checks of miter and bevel angle accuracy
- Bearing Lubrication: Annual service of pivot points and sliding mechanisms
- Motor Maintenance: Periodic cleaning of motor housing and air passages
- Electrical Inspection: Annual cord and switch inspection for safety compliance
